Salvatore W. Pirrotta

Sal Pirrotta began practicing law  in 2000.  Mr. Pirrotta is a commercial litigator.  He represents a wide range of business entities and owners, executives, medical professionals, attorneys and law firms, agricultural growers and suppliers, and individuals.

Commercial Litigation

Mr. Pirrotta provides clients with guidance and counsel on bet-the-company litigation, responses to claims, and procedural compliance advice.  He represents companies and individuals pre-suit and at the trial and appellate levels, as well as for matters related to governmental regulatory and licensing issues.  He practices primarily in the U.S. District Courts and state courts throughout Michigan.  Mr. Pirrotta’s experience with complex commercial litigation is strengthened by excellent working relationships with state and federal governmental agencies and departments.  His commercial litigation experiences includes representing large companies (such as Tier One automotive suppliers), midsize companies (such as marine transportation and construction companies), and small companies (such as owners of small farms, retail locations, restaurants, and taverns).  That commercial experience extends to the shareholders and owners of large, midsize, and small companies, including shareholder disputes.

Professional Liability

Mr. Pirrotta’s practice includes professional liability work (malpractice defense) for professionals, including attorneys and law firms and business-to-business services that have been sued by former clients and others.  He regularly counsels attorneys regarding issues involving conflicts of interest and the Rules of Professional Conduct.

Licensing and Regulatory

Mr. Pirrotta represents companies and individuals in a variety of licensing and regulatory matters.  That representation includes assisting in the defense of federal investigations; Michigan Liquor Control Commission licensing matters, investigations, and complaints; and professional licensing investigations and complaints.

Agriculture and Farms

Mr. Pirrotta represents agribusiness companies and owners, from wholesalers, farms, to storefronts.  That representation includes providing PACA counseling and litigation services to growers, suppliers, and sellers of fresh fruits and vegetables, as well as representing farms and nurseries related to claims for crop damage (such as from defective fertilizer).

ERISA Litigation

Mr. Pirrotta handles Employment Retirement Income Security Act (ERISA) litigation matters.  He represents businesses, employers,  retirement and welfare plans, third-party claim administrators, hospitals, individuals, and others in connection with claims for benefits, breaches of fiduciary duties, and other disputes arising under ERISA.

Healthcare Reimbursement

Mr. Pirrotta litigates on behalf of medical providers seeking insurance reimbursement on patient accounts.  He pursues wrongful denials of hospital claims by third-party payers, including no-fault carriers, health insurance plans, government plans, and governmental entities.  His practice involves counseling and advising health-system clients about reimbursement issues for all varieties of medical claims.
